MXO45LV/MXO45HSLV
METAL DIP CLOCK OSCILLATOR
FEATURES
• Standard 14 Pin or 8 Pin DIP Footprint
• HCMOS/TTL Compatible
• Fundamental and 3RD Overtone Crystals
• Frequency Range 1.0 – 50.0 MHz
• Frequency Stability, ±50 ppm Standard
(±25 ppm and ±20 ppm available)
• +3.3Vdc Operation
• Operating Temperature to –40°C to +85°C
• Output Enable Option
• RoHS/Green Compliant (6/6)
DESCRIPTION
The MXO45LV/MXO45HSLV is a DIP packaged
Clock oscillator offering reliable performance at
an economical cost. The enhanced stability
means it is the perfect choice for today’s
communications applications that require tight
frequency control.

PACKAGING
Product is packaged in plastic trays.
Typical packaging format is as follows:
50 pcs./Plastic Tray.
Tray size is approximately 180x136x18mm (LxWxH).
2 Trays/Anti-Static Bag (100 pcs.)
or
10 Trays/Anti-Static Bag (500 pcs.).
Bag height for 10 Trays is approximately 175mm.
1 Anti-Static Bag/Cardboard Carton.
Master-pack multiple Cardboard Cartons in a larger carton.
8 Cardboard Cartons (10 trays per carton) is approximately
460x380x400mm (LxWxH).
